* Chlorine Dioxide Generation.
The Capital Controls T70GS4000 new mini chlorine dioxide generator is ideal for applications such as Legionella control in cooling water and building services industries.
With a generating range of 2g/day to 10g/hour, the equipment can be used for safe, on-demand production of chlorine dioxide where very low dosage rates are required.
In addition to its use in controlling Legionella, the T70GS4000 can be used for primary water disinfection, THM reduction, iron and manganese removal in potable water treatment, wastewater treatment, and, in the food and beverage industry, for microbiological control.
The leadership line of Capital Controls chlorine dioxide generation equipment has a range of 2g/day to 10,000g/hour.
* SmartMeter Metering.
SmartMeter water meters address the global need for economic smart metering solutions.
The new SM700 and SM150VR no-moving-parts water meters provide accurate measurement of water flows throughout the entire product lifetime using tried and tested technology.
Both feature life-long accuracy and a 15-year battery life to provide significant savings in whole-life costs when compared to traditional metering technology.
The SM150VR model is a visually read meter, while the SM150VR Plus version enables additional functionality as an AMR-enabled meter.
A unique feature of the SM150VR Plus is the ability to provide instant meter reads and "doorstep billing" through an inductive coil in the meter and a hand-held printer device.
Advantages of the system include reduced billing costs for the water company; confirmation of bill receipt; accurate bills based on actual data; electronic data input; and instant print out of the bill and receipt of payment.
The SmartMeter SM700 is available as a visually read meter or in a fully AMR-enabled format using inductive pads, radio communications device or any form of automatic meter reading technology (AMR device) connecting to the direct read interface through the encoded or pulse meter application.
* Dry Emergency Scrubber.
The EST Dry Emergency Chlorine Scrubber, Type DES 3000 is a standardised, one-ton system designed to mitigate accidental chlorine gas releases in municipal and industrial applications in accordance with Uniform Fire Code requirements.
The new scrubber provides a safe, user-friendly and low-maintenance alternative to wet scrubbers and features lower long-term maintenance and operating costs than traditional wet scrubber systems.
* Sodium Hypochlorite Generation.
A standardised ClorTec Series MCT on-site sodium hypochlorite generating system meets disinfection requirements for 12 to 36 lb/day and 5.4 to 16.3 kg/day of chlorine equivalent.
The Series MCT systems are supplied in a factory-tested, skid-mounted configuration and come with standard features including a high-efficiency electrolytic cell or cells, on-board water softener, integrated control panel/power supply and brine proportioning pump.
Standardisation of the ClorTec MCT ensures easy ordering, and the compact design allows for easy maintenance and system expansion.
* UV Disinfection.
In addition, the company recently announced the acquisition of the business of Quay Technologies of Berkshire, UK, manufacturers of a proprietary microwave ultraviolet (UV) technology for use in water and wastewater disinfection.
The Quay Technologies novel disinfection method offers a modular 4-lamp design to meet varying flow rates and demands and a standard three-year lamp life guarantee on each system reduces maintenance concerns and whole-life costs.
The Quay UV systems will be offered to the water and wastewater treatment market under the new brand name, MicroDynamics, and supplies both closed-vessel and open-channel systems.
